Engage with Community Educators

The Learning Series for Community Leaders is a monthly educational series aimed at providing our community with valuable resources and knowledge to enhance community health, leadership, and overall well-being. The series will focus on a variety of relevant topics that impact communities, and each session will feature expert speakers, tools, and resources to help strengthen community resilience.
Volunteer for Research at FSU
Researchers at Florida State University are leading a variety of research studies, including clinical trials, and many rely on volunteers from the community. FSU Health will be launching a community research engagement platform called FSU Health ResearchLink in Fall of 2026. Stay tuned for more information.
